Title: The Innovations of John F. Bischof
Introduction
John F. Bischof is a notable inventor based in Cleveland, TN (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of electrical engineering, particularly in the design of switching apparatuses. His innovative approach has led to the development of a unique patent that enhances the functionality and safety of electrical systems.
Latest Patents
John F. Bischof holds a patent for an "Enclosed transfer switching apparatus having fuses connected at load." This invention features a pair of slides that are linearly reciprocally movable in opposite directions by a single operator handle. The design includes pins that interact with dog-leg slots of levers affixed to rotary operating mechanisms of a pair of switches. This mechanism allows for the operation of one switch to an ON condition while keeping the other switch in an OFF condition, and vice versa. The fuses connected to the load side terminals of the switches are designed to remove power when the switches are in the OFF position, ensuring safety and efficiency.
